Inclusion criteria

Inclusion criteria: 1. patients aged 18 to 80 years with surgical NSCLC; 2. patients with suspected lung cancer on radiologic examination and those who will undergo curative surgery; 3. patients with lung cancer suspected to be staged as stage II~IIIa by histologic and/or cytologic examination; 4. patients who can be treated with radical surgery; 5. patients' informed consent is obtained after they are informed about the program.

Exclusion criteria

Exclusion criteria: 1. history of malignant tumor within the last 5 years; 2. multiple primary lung cancers that cannot be completely resected; 3. pathology of frozen sections or paraffin sections confirming that the tumor is not NSCLC; 4. pathologic staging of Stage IIIb and later; 5. the blood sample is substandard or unavailable; 6. refusal to sign the informed consent form; 7. those whom the investigator considers unsuitable for enrollment.
